Working Principles

The S-817B52AY-Z2-U operates based on the principle of feedback control. It compares the output voltage to a reference voltage and adjusts the internal circuitry to maintain a stable output. By continuously monitoring the output voltage, the regulator compensates for any fluctuations in the input voltage, ensuring a consistent and regulated output.
